Sony Ericsson W800




Design Sony Ericsson W800
Form factor:
Candybar
Dimensions:
3.90 x 1.80 x 0.80 inches (100 x 46 x 20.5 mm)
Weight:
3.49 oz (99 g)
the average is 4.8 oz (137 g)
Design features:
Numeric keypad, Soft keys (2)
Side Keys:
Left: Multimedia control; Right: Volume control, Camera shutter
Display Sony Ericsson W800
Screen Resolution:?Screen resolution refers to the size of the image received on the screen in pixels
176 x 220 pixels
Technology:
TFT
Colors:
262 144
Camera Sony Ericsson W800
Camera:
2 megapixels
Flash:
Yes
Features:
Autofocus, Digital zoom
Camcorder:
Yes
Hardware Sony Ericsson W800
Built-in storage:
0.032 GB
Storage expansion:
Memory Stick Pro Duo, Memory Stick Duo
Battery Sony Ericsson W800
Talk time:
9.00 hours
the average is 11 h (675 min)
Stand-by time:
16.7 days (400 hours)
the average is 20 days (477 h)
Capacity:
900 mAh
Type:
Li - Polymer
Multimedia Sony Ericsson W800
Music player Supported formats:
MP3, AAC
Video playback Supported formats:
MPEG4, 3GPP
Radio:
FM
Internet browsing Sony Ericsson W800
Browser supports:
WAP 2.0
Technology Sony Ericsson W800
GSM:
900, 1800, 1900 MHz
Data:
GPRS
Global Roaming:
Yes
Phone features Sony Ericsson W800
Phonebook:
500 entries, Caller groups, Multiple numbers per contact, Picture ID, Ring ID
Organizer:
Calculator, Timer, Stopwatch, Wallet, Alarm, To-Do, Flashlight, Calendar
Messaging:
SMS, Predictive text input (T9), MMS
E-mail:
IMAP, POP3, SMTP
JAVA:
Midp 2.0
Games:
JAVA downloadable
Connectivity Sony Ericsson W800
Bluetooth:?Bluetooth is used to exchange data between nearby mobile devices.
2.0
Profiles:
Headset (HSP), Handsfree (HFP), Dial-up networking (DUN), Generic Object Exchange (GOEP), File Transfer (FTP), Object Push (OPP), Generic Access (GAP), Serial Port (SPP), Human Interface Device (HID), Basic Imaging (BIP), Synchronization (SP)
USB:?Universal Serial Bus
Yes
Other:
Computer sync, Infrared, SyncML
Other features Sony Ericsson W800
Notifications:
Music ringtones (MP3), Polyphonic ringtones (40 voices), Vibration, Phone profiles, Speakerphone
Voice dialing, Voice recording, TTY/TDD
Regulatory Approval Sony Ericsson W800
FCC approval :
 
Date approved:
12 Jul 2005
FCC ID value: PY7A1022013
FCC measured SAR :
 
Head:
0.55 W/kg
Measured in:
1900 MHz
Body:
0.87 W/kg
Measured in:
1900 MHz
Availability Sony Ericsson W800
Officially announced:
01 Mar 2005

 The Honor 600 Lite features a body crafted using ?rocket? technology

A week after the Honor 600 Lite went on sale, the company shared details about one of the device's key features?its metal body. It is crafted using technology employed in the aerospace and automotive industries.

The Honor 600 Lite is built around an all-metal frame created using vacuum die-casting technology instead of traditional stamping. This new method allows for complex geometric shapes to be achieved directly in the mold, while the frame's wall thickness is less than 0.25 mm?a feat impossible to achieve with conventional machining without sacrificing strength.
